Pateriça Zeytin Beach

Pateriça Zeytin Beach is a hidden paradise, located between two villages. The beach is known for its warm, clean sea that doesn't get deep right away. Even after going 100 meters into the sea, the water only reaches your height, making it an ideal location for families with small children. The sea is so clear that it resembles an aquarium, allowing visitors to see the bottom. The beach is equipped with sunbeds, showers, and lodges, providing all the necessary amenities for a comfortable beach day. However, it is recommended to come prepared as the beach is far from civilization and does not have a WC. Visitors have the option to either rent a sun lounger and umbrella in the club area for a fee or bring their own. The beach is accessible by a 5 km dirt road, which is worth the journey for the tranquility it offers. Visitors can pull their car to the right between the 1st village and the 2nd village and enjoy a barbecue with a view. Despite its amenities and natural beauty, the beach remains quiet and calm, offering a peaceful retreat for its visitors.
